It is October 29th, 1897, and Private Investigator Declan Ward arrives at Blake Manor to find a missing woman.
What he finds is the Grand Séance and a group of mystics who have gathered from all corners of the world – waiting for All Hallow’s Eve, the night when the veil between worlds is thinnest. The night to tear down the barrier and speak to the dead.

Interview and interrogate your suspects, keep a record of all evidence, motivations, and clues in your journal, and confront them about their motivations when you’re certain of your deductions. Uncover the truth about Blake Manor and the mysterious séance that has brought everyone together.
Navigate Blake Manor's haunted corridors and uncover its secrets as you race against time to save Miss Deane.

Investigate the manor, solve environmental clues and reach the forbidden areas of the hotel…and beyond.
But be careful - each action counts the day down. Be in the right place at the right time to catch critical events pertinent to your investigation. Everyone has their own agendas and schedules – it could truly be a loss to miss out on a quick chat by mistiming your actions. And who knows what hidden secrets lie in wait once you’ve turned in for the night...

Brought to you by the creators of The Darkside Detective and Raw Fury, The Séance of Blake Manor is depicted by a beautiful comic-book art style. Inspired by Irish Mythology and the spiritualist movements of the Victorian era, players are cast into a first-person narrative adventure, blending the supernatural with a classic detective mystery. With its striking cutscenes, compelling narrative and dynamic soundtrack that reacts to the environment around you, Blake Manor and its secrets will leave you on the edge of your seat morning through night.

It's a pretty captivating whodunnit that leans heavily into Irish mythology, but I wish it leaned into the puzzle aspect more. The time gating and topic discussion systems are a higlight for the game, as they incentivize you to carefully decide which clues are worth exploring, which I think is a great innovation for a detective/mystery game. The story was intriguing and while I took a bit of issue with the micro-exposition segment at the final reveal, I thought the experience as a whole was fulfilling. On the flipside, the puzzles, another common element in mystery games were pretty lackluster and were bordering on handholding. The majority of puzzles you will encounter comes in the form of sigils, which are variations of the famous "connect the dots without crossing over a line more than once" puzzle, which stop being difficult after you get the gist of it after the first two or three. The rest of the puzzles involve finding something or figuring out a code, which is usually spelled out for you via a note right next to the code giving you the exact code. 7.5/10
